1. Introduction
 JMS578 can convert SATA 6Gb/s (768MB/s) (theoretically) to USB3.1 Gen1, which can be used for SSD, HDD, ODD
VL160 can convert USB3.1 to TYPE-C USB3.1.

The power supply uses SCT2650's DCDC, with 12V and 5V path management.
This solution is compatible with solid-state drives, 2.5-inch and 3.5-inch mechanical hard disks, as detailed below.
2. SSD/2.5-inch/3.5-inch mechanical hard disk description
This solution is compatible with solid-state drives, 2.5-inch and 3.5-inch mechanical hard disks.
General solid-state drives and 2.5-inch mechanical hard disks are powered by 5V, and general 3.5-inch mechanical hard disks use 5V+12V dual power supply.
When using a solid-state drive or a 2.5-inch hard drive, you don't need a 12V power supply, only a 5V power supply is needed. Therefore, the following power supply part does not need to be welded. This power supply solution cannot drive a 3.5-inch hard drive without 12V.

The following figure shows that a 2.5-inch mechanical hard drive can be driven without welding the DCDC part of the circuit
. When using a 3.5-inch hard drive, this part of the power supply needs to be welded, and the power supply needs to be powered by a 12V adapter. It is also compatible with the 5V of a 2.5-inch hard drive. When welding,
please note that when using USB5V without welding DCDC, you need to weld 0 ohms or a fuse here
. When using a 12V power supply to weld DCDC, you do not need to weld here, just paste it blank.
Otherwise, the 5V of DCDC may flow back to the USB5V .
In actual personal tests, after welding DCDC, there is no backflow phenomenon when welding 0 ohms 5V here, but it is recommended to disconnect it.
3.Layout part
TYPE-C, USB3.0, USB2.0 part uses 90 ohm impedance, SATA part uses 100 ohm impedance
This design uses:
four-layer board, 1.0 board thickness
JLC04101H-7628, you can get it for free

5.1 Seagate Galaxy X18 ST16000NM000J
Brand: Seagate Galaxy X18
Model: ST16000NM000J
Hard disk type: 3.5-inch mechanical hard disk Vertical disk
capacity: 16TB
Cache: 256M
Speed: 7200 rpm
Use: Brand
new disk I just got a brand new disk, so I took this one to operate.
Using this tool, you can initialize the hard disk normally, create new partitions normally, format normally, and modify the volume label normally.
The speed in USB3 mode is OK, and both reading and writing can reach 250MB/s, which is the ceiling of the mechanical hard disk tested so far

Brand: Seagate Skyhawk
Model: ST4000VX007
Hard disk type: 3.5-inch mechanical hard disk Vertical disk
capacity: 4TB
Cache: 64M
Rotation speed: 5900 rpm
Use: 1 year
Reading speed is 160MB/s in USB3 mode
and writing speed is 88MB/s in USB3 mode
Considering that this disk is about to be full, the magnetic head is basically active in the inner circle of the disk, that is, the area with lower linear speed, and the speed is not as good as the writing speed of 120MB/s of the previous Seagate Skyhawk ST1000LM035 hard disk. Therefore, the unsatisfactory writing speed should be the reason why the hard disk is almost full.

6. Summary
We have tested many hard drives, including 2.5-inch/3.5-inch mechanical and solid-state drives, which are highly versatile and can reach a maximum reading speed of 400MB/s. It is
simple and practical, with simple peripherals, and 2.5-inch/3.5-inch hard mechanical drives and solid-state drives are universal. Suitable for the hard disk removed from the old computer to make use of the old things.
